Benefits of Man Having Full Custody
Full or sole custody (as it is called in many states) is something that a court determines if the two parents cannot agree and/or if the child or children are too young to make a decision. The basis for determining who gets custody is always going to focus on what is in the best interest of the child, not to mention who the best person to raise the child is. Many people would go as far as to say that there is no benefit of man having full custody, as children may be better off with both parents. Still, the benefit of custody for either parent can be priceless. If you are a father and you do not have custody of you children, then you are missing out on the greatest moments of their lives.
One of the benefits of a father having full custody of his children is that if by chance, the mother is unfit, then a father’s mind will be at ease as long as he knows that his children are in a safe haven with him. Having full custody of your children would also mean that you do not have to deal with unnecessary court issues. Children can benefit from having a strong father figure, and fathers can benefit by having their children around full time and seeing their children grow up.
To get full custody, you must prove that you are the better parent. Just as when a woman goes to court to fight for her children, if a man does the same thing, it might show that he is a reliable parent determined to do what is right for his children
Contrary to popular belief, seeking full custody is not a war game. It is always about what is absolutely best for the children involved. So if you are simply trying to get full custody as a means of retaliation against your ex-wife, then you probably should not seek custody at all. This is a crucial point to realize and as a father, you will need to be focused solely on what is best for your children.
